Common Energy Wasting Areas and Their Impact on Bills
Many homeowners are unaware of the common areas in their homes that waste energy and, subsequently, increase utility bills. One significant contributor is improper insulation. When attics, walls, and floors lack adequate insulation, heated or cooled air escapes, forcing your HVAC system to work harder to maintain a comfortable temperature. This not only raises energy bills but also contributes to an uncomfortable living environment.
Another energy-wasting area is outdated appliances. Older models often operate less efficiently, consuming more electricity and water. Transitioning to energy-efficient appliances can result in substantial savings on utility costs in the long run. Additionally, be mindful of phantom loads from electronics that remain plugged in. Devices like chargers, televisions, and computers can draw power even when turned off, subtly increasing your bills.
Tips: To improve energy efficiency, start by conducting an energy audit of your home. Identify areas where insulation can be enhanced, and consider sealing drafts around windows and doors. Upgrading to energy-efficient appliances can also make a significant difference. Lastly, utilize power strips for electronic devices to easily manage and cut off power to multiple items when not in use.
Effective Insulation Techniques for Energy Conservation
Effective insulation is a crucial component of improving energy efficiency in any home. By preventing warm or cool air from escaping, proper insulation can significantly reduce the reliance on heating and cooling systems. One of the most effective techniques is to use high-quality materials such as fiberglass, foam, or cellulose, which trap air and create a barrier against heat transfer. Homeowners can insulate their attics, walls, and floors to maintain a consistent indoor temperature throughout the year. In particular, attic insulation is essential, as a substantial amount of heat escapes through the roof.
Additionally, sealing gaps and cracks around windows, doors, and outlets can enhance overall insulation effectiveness. Weatherstripping and caulking can easily be applied to eliminate drafts, allowing your heating and cooling systems to function more efficiently. Another innovative technique is installing radiant barrier systems, which reflect heat away in the summer and retain warmth in the winter. Both traditional insulation methods and modern solutions contribute to energy conservation and can lead to noticeable reductions in utility bills over time. These strategies not only make your home more comfortable but also contribute to a more sustainable environment.
Energy-Efficient Appliances: Choosing the Right Options
When it comes to improving energy efficiency in your home, selecting the right energy-efficient appliances is a critical step. According to the U.S. Department of Energy, appliances that carry the ENERGY STAR certification can save homeowners as much as 30% on their energy bills compared to standard models. These appliances are designed to consume less electricity or water without compromising performance, which makes them a smart investment for both the environment and your wallet.
In addition to the cost savings, energy-efficient appliances can significantly reduce greenhouse gas emissions. A study by the American Council for an Energy-Efficient Economy (ACEEE) found that if all U.S. households replaced their old appliances with ENERGY STAR certified models, it could lead to the avoidance of more than 40 million metric tons of carbon dioxide emissions annually—equivalent to the emissions from over eight million cars. With the long-term benefits of reduced utility bills and a smaller carbon footprint, choosing energy-efficient appliances is an essential aspect of responsible home ownership.

Smart Home Technologies to Enhance Energy Savings
Smart home technologies have transformed the way we manage energy consumption, making it easier than ever to enhance energy savings in our homes. By integrating devices such as smart thermostats, homeowners can automatically adjust heating and cooling settings based on their schedules and preferences. These devices utilize algorithms and machine learning to optimize energy use, resulting in lower utility bills without sacrificing comfort.
Additionally, smart lighting systems offer another layer of efficiency. By using motion sensors and smart bulbs, lights can be programmed to turn off when a room is unoccupied or adjust their brightness based on the time of day. This not only conserves energy but can also extend the lifespan of your lighting fixtures. Furthermore, smart plugs allow homeowners to control their appliances remotely, enabling them to turn off devices that may be consuming energy unnecessarily.
Overall, the adoption of smart home technologies not only streamlines energy management but also empowers homeowners to make informed decisions about their energy consumption. With the ability to monitor usage patterns and receive real-time feedback, individuals can identify areas for improvement, leading to more sustainable living environments and significant savings on utility bills.
